How to Make Melt in Your Mouth Chicken
Step 1: Preheat the Oven
Start by setting your oven to 375°F (190°C). This temperature is ideal for cooking chicken breasts all the way through while giving the topping just enough time to turn beautifully golden and slightly crisp without drying out the meat. Make sure your rack is placed in the center of the oven for even heat distribution.
Step 2: Prepare the Creamy Topping
In a medium-sized bowl, blend together the mayonnaise or Greek yogurt, freshly grated Parmesan, garlic powder, seasoned salt, and ground black pepper. Mixing these up before meeting the chicken ensures a perfectly uniform, velvety coating with every bite. If you’re using Greek yogurt, you’ll notice an appealing tang that lifts the dish even more.
Step 3: Coat the Chicken Breasts
Lay the chicken breasts flat in your baking dish (glass or metal both work). Spoon the creamy topping over each breast, spreading it evenly thickly across the top. Be generous—this is what gives each piece that dreamy, melt-in-your-mouth finish and keeps your chicken unbelievably juicy as it bakes.
Step 4: Bake to Perfection
Place the dish in your preheated oven and bake for about 45 minutes. The chicken should be fully cooked through (165°F/74°C internally if you have a thermometer), with the topping bubbling and turning a lovely golden brown. Your kitchen will start smelling wonderful about halfway through! If you like an extra-toasty topping, broil for the last two minutes while keeping a careful eye on it.
Step 5: Optionally Garnish and Serve
If you’re feeling a little fancy, sprinkle freshly chopped parsley or even a bit of extra Parmesan over your Melt in Your Mouth Chicken just before serving. It adds a pop of color and a fresh touch that balances the richness.

Make Ahead and Storage
Storing Leftovers
Any leftover Melt in Your Mouth Chicken should be cooled to room temperature before storing. Transfer the chicken to an airtight container and refrigerate; it will stay perfectly moist and tasty for up to three days. The flavors continue to mingle, making leftovers extra delicious!
Freezing
If you want to make a big batch ahead, Melt in Your Mouth Chicken freezes surprisingly well. Wrap individual cooked portions tightly in foil or plastic wrap, then store in a freezer-safe container or bag for up to three months. For the very best texture, thaw overnight in the fridge before reheating.
Reheating
Reheat leftovers in a 350°F (175°C) oven for 10–15 minutes, or until heated through. This helps maintain the original juicy texture and ensures the topping crisps up again. The microwave works in a pinch; just use a lower power setting to prevent the sauce from separating.
FAQs
Can I use chicken thighs instead of breasts?
Absolutely! Chicken thighs will be even juicier and withstand the oven beautifully. Just keep in mind that thighs may cook a bit faster or slower depending on their size, so start checking them for doneness 5–10 minutes earlier than you would chicken breasts.
Is it better to use mayonnaise or Greek yogurt?
Either will turn out delicious. Mayonnaise gives a classic rich creaminess, while Greek yogurt offers a tangier and lighter vibe. It really comes down to your mood or dietary preference—both deliver that signature Melt in Your Mouth Chicken texture.
Can I add other seasonings?
Of course! This dish is super flexible. Add a pinch of smoked paprika, crushed red pepper flakes, or Italian herbs to the topping for a unique twist. Freshly minced garlic or shallot can also add a deeper, more aromatic accent.
What should I do if my topping isn’t browning?
If the topping isn’t as golden as you’d like by the end of baking, simply pop the dish under the broiler for a minute or two. Watch closely so it doesn’t burn—the cheese topping will bubble and brown quickly!
Can I prepare Melt in Your Mouth Chicken ahead of time?
Yes! Assemble everything up to the point of baking and keep it tightly covered in the fridge for a few hours or overnight. Bake when you’re ready to serve, adding just a couple of extra minutes if it goes into the oven cold.

Melt in Your Mouth Chicken Recipe
- Total Time: 55 minutes
- Yield: 4 servings 1x
- Diet: Gluten Free
Description
This Melt in Your Mouth Chicken recipe is a delicious and easy way to prepare moist and flavorful chicken breasts coated with a savory topping.
Ingredients
Ingredients:
- 4 boneless, skinless chicken breasts
- 1 cup mayonnaise or Greek yogurt
- 1/2 cup freshly grated Parmesan cheese
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der
- 1/2 teaspoon seasoned salt (e.g., Lowry’s)
- 1/2 teaspoon ground black pepper
Instructions
- Preheat Oven: Set your oven to 375°F (190°C).
- Prepare the Topping: In a small bowl, mix together the mayonnaise (or Greek yogurt), Parmesan cheese, garlic powder, seasoned salt, and black pepper.
- Coat the Chicken: Spread the mixture evenly over the top of each chicken breast.
- Bake: Place the coated chicken breasts in a glass baking dish or metal pan. Bake for 45 minutes, or until the chicken is cooked through and the topping is golden brown.
- Garnish: Optionally, sprinkle with chopped parsley before serving.
